Transaction 025248e905e076f789dc57ccb177e620874bf92ea439878d2925159899a9140c
1 Input
1 Output
-
025248e905e076f789dc57ccb177e620874bf92ea439878d2925159899a9140c:0
- value
- 106896743
- script pubkey
- OP_0 OP_PUSHBYTES_20 6c5cb0a32a3aed42c6336c5d46050ec19375f54d
- address
- bc1qd3wtpge28tk5933nd3w5vpgwcxfhta2dmddpja